Enders Army Mod

Ender’s Army Mod (1.19.4) adds more end-themed mobs to Minecraft, as well as mechanics centered around these new monsters.

Features:

  • Falling Ship: A structure that can sometimes be seen falling from the sky, and lands in a heap. You will find many valuable resources, but be careful, as a shadow monster lurks nearby.
  • Shadow Monsters: These patches of moving shadow always search for players and emit otherworldly sounds and a low heartbeat when around the player. They transform into baby ender monsters when they reach the player.
  • Bosses and Mobs:
    • Bosses are summoned from shadow shards, which are dropped by ender monster babies.
    • Ender monster babies: These small critters spawn out of Shadow Monsters and try to attack players. They are very weak.
    • Lord Of The Claw: This monstrous boss is the first you will encounter, and has many attacks. It will slam the ground and shoot projectiles in a ring, as well as charge towards the player.
      It drops its special weapon, the Garnered Clawhammer.
    • Lord Of the Maw: The second boss players encounter is not an easy one. It constantly dives in and out of the ground, making a beeline for the player. It destroys the blocks around it, and its trail of destruction can trap players. If you get caught, you will get hit for lots of damage. Running is advised.
      It drops its special weapon, the Mangled Mawstaff.
    • Lord Of The Wall: This is the third boss players will encounter. It resembles a ravager but is equipped with cannons and a very sturdy shield for a face. It shoots a constant stream of projectiles at the player, backing away as it does so. It periodically shoots three fireballs that explode the landscape.
      It drops its special weapon, the Hardened Axeblaster.
    • Lord Of The End: The last boss players will encounter, and has many attacks. It uses its dagger to stab the ground, causing fangs to appear and snap at the player. It can also perform an AOE attack using its staff. It will slash players and spin at them, causing fast-moving slashes to move towards the player. At half health, it retreats and summons its army, and when the army is defeated, It shows itself again. When killed, this boss drops its weapons.
    • Dimension Rifts: Rips in space can spawn in your world, and spawn groups of ender monsters when approached. What monsters they spawn are dependent on how many bosses you have killed.
  • Weapons:
    • Gnarled clawhammer: left click: slashes at anything in front of the player. Right click: shoot an AOE attack with a 5-second cooldown.
    • Mangled Clawstaff: left click: bite enemies in front of the player with extended reach. Right-click: Shoot a shadow fang, which only affects other players.
    • Hardened Axeblaster: left-click: shoot a small projectile. Right click: shoot a fireball similar to Lord Of The Wall’s fireball attack.
    • Night Sword: dropped by the Lord Of The End, this sword hits hard but swings slowly. (currently no abilities)
    • Night dagger: A fast-swinging sword. (currently no abilities)
    • Night staff: left click: shoot various projectiles.
    • Orb Of Dominance: in main hand (passive) : buffs player with regeneration, haste, and resistance, but debuffs player with weakness. right click: heals all players with a 40-second cooldown.
